Brief summary

The purpose of this research study is to look at how safe and useful a drug called azacitidine in combination with a drug called venetoclax, is in people with accelerated or blast phase BRC-ABL negative myeloproliferative neoplasms.

Detailed description

All participants in this study will receive azacitidine and venetoclax. This study will be done in multiple stages: Safety Run-In Period - 7 participants will receive the study drugs to ensure that the combination is safe and tolerable. Stage 1 - About 15 participants will receive the study drugs and will be evaluated to see whether they respond to the study drugs. Stage 2 - If enough participants in Stage 1 respond to the study drugs, then Stage 2 will begin. During this stage, an additional 25 participants will take part in the study to further see if participants respond to the study drugs.

Interventions

DRUGAzacitidine

Azacitidine is a hypomethylating agent that works by activating certain genes in the body to help cells mature and to kill abnormal bone marrow cells.

DRUGVenetoclax

Venetoclax is a drug that blocks a protein called B-cell lymphoma (BCL2) protein from working. BCL2 is a protein that helps control whether a cell lives or dies and is thought to help cancer cells to live. Blocking BCL2 is believed to help kill cancer cells.

Inclusion criteria

* Ability to voluntarily provide written informed consent. * Documented diagnosis per World Health Organization (WHO) 2016 criteria of BCR-ABL negative myeloproliferative neoplasms (MPN). * Documented MPN transformation to accelerated phase (AP) or blast phase (BP) without prior blast reduction therapy for their AP/BP disease. * Eastern Cooperative Oncology Group (ECOG) performance status 0-2. * Adequate organ function. * Must practice at least one reliable method of birth-control starting at least on cycle 1 day 1 until at least 90 days after the last dose of study drug. * Female participants of childbearing potential must have a negative serum pregnancy test within 14 days prior to cycle 1 day 1.

Exclusion criteria

* History of allogeneic stem cell transplant for MPN. * Previous treatment with venetoclax, navitoclax, azacytidine or other hypomethylating agents (HMA). * White blood cell count \>25 x 10\^9/L. * Current enrollment in another interventional study. * Presence of any active uncontrolled infection such as bacterial or fungal infections progressing despite adequate antimicrobial treatment. * Myocardial infarction in the preceding 3 months. * Active human immunodeficiency virus (HIV), hepatitis B (HBV), hepatitis C (HCV) infection. * History of active malignancy in the previous 2 years. * Any psychiatric illness or social circumstances or significant co-morbid conditions that may compromise study participation. * Pregnant or breastfeeding women. * Patients with known central nervous system (CNS) involvement with acute myeloid leukemia (AML) or CNS extramedullary hematopoiesis. * Patients with t (15;17) * Patients who have received strong and/or moderate CYP3A inducers within 7 days prior to the initiation of study treatment. * Active COVID-19 infection. * History of prior blast-reduction therapy for AP/BP-MPN. * Preceding history MDS, chronic myelomonocytic leukemia (CMML), and other myelodysplastic syndromes (MDS)/MPN overlap syndromes.
